If bull reds are in, there are plenty of 20-30 lb fish swimming around in the channel and jetties areas. 30+ lbs would be an exceptional specimen, especially from a kayak. If bull reds are out, then it comes down to finding the fattest 26-27" long fish, and 9-10 lbs (each) will probably take it. The long term LA average weight of a 27" redfish is 8 lbs. Redfish of that size in big lake have been running closer to 7 lbs the past few years, but once in a while a fish significantly above average shows up. |
